The three Math Idol judges have been eliminating contestants all day! The number of one-step equations and two-step equations who have been eliminated today is equal to 1120. If three times the number of one-step equations minus twice the number of two-step equations is equal to 1300, how many two-step equations auditioned today? I tried this but I don't know if its right, someone help please (:

OpenStudy (anonymous):

Assume that x = single step, y = double step operations. x + y = 1120 3x - 2y = 1300 x = 1120 - y 3360-3y -2y = 1300 -5y = -2060 y = 412 x + 412 = 1120 x = 708 So you have 708 double step operations and 412 single step operations. This is what I had. Correct or nah?
